Silgan Holdings (SLGN) Could Be 23% Undervalued Following Its Dividend Reaffirmation

Simply Wall St reports Silgan Holdings (SLGN) reaffirmed its quarterly cash dividend of $0.21 per share, with a Sept. 1, 2026 record date and Sept. 15, 2026 payment date. The stock at $42.32 is down 11.85% over 7 days and 8.77% over 30 days. A narrative estimates fair value at $54.77, about 23% above the last close.

Silgan Q2 profit slips despite higher sales

Silgan has posted a net income of $75.8m for the second quarter (Q2) of 2026, down from $89m in the same period of 2025. Quarterly sales reached $1.64bn, an increase of $104.1m, or 7%, from a year earlier. Silgan (SLGN) Q2 2026 Earnings Call Transcript

Silgan (SLGN) held its Q2 2026 earnings call, reporting net sales of about $1.6 billion, up 7% year over year, and adjusted EPS of $0.98. Adjusted EPS was below the prior year due to lower adjusted EBIT. The company confirmed 2026 adjusted EPS guidance of $3.73 to $3.93 and gave Q3 2026 adjusted EPS guidance of $1.21 to $1.31.
